1
Lie flat on a bench with back and head firmly supported, feet flat on floor or bench. Position body perpendicular to bench with hips at bench level. Grip barbell with hands slightly wider than shoulder-width, arms fully extended above chest.
2
Unrack the barbell or press from the starting position. Establish a firm grip with palms facing forward. Engage core and press shoulder blades slightly into the bench. Maintain neutral wrist position throughout the movement.
3
Lower the barbell in a controlled manner by bending elbows, moving the bar downward and slightly toward the lower chest in an arc. Lower until elbows are approximately 90 degrees or slightly below parallel to the bench. Maintain control and do not bounce the weight off the chest.
4
Press the barbell upward by extending elbows and contracting chest muscles, driving through the palms. Return to starting position with arms nearly fully extended (slight elbow bend at top). Exhale during the concentric phase and maintain tension throughout.
